President Ilham Aliyev: Armenian State Bears Full Responsibility for the Khojaly Genocide

Baku: "The Khojaly genocide is a bloody war crime committed by the Armenian state, by Armenian fascists, against the Azerbaijanis - against humanity; it is a war crime against humanity," President of the Republic of Azerbaijan Ilham Aliyev said during his meeting with the representatives of the Khojaly district community.

According to Azeri-Press News Agency, President Aliyev emphasized that the Armenian state bears full responsibility for the tragic events. He highlighted that in a single night, over 600 innocent civilians, including 106 women and 63 children, were brutally murdered by what he referred to as Armenian fascists. Additionally, 150 individuals went missing, with the presumption that they were also victims of the Armenian forces. The president pointed out that the remains of some of these missing individuals were discovered following the occupation and subsequently laid to rest.
